At a news conference held yesterday morning with U.N. Secretary-General Kofi Annan (!) and MTV President Christina Norman, Jay-Z announced plans for a world tour with the purpose of raising awareness of the worlds water crisis.
The tour will take Jay to many places currently affected by the crisis, where hell visit with the people during the day, and put on live performances at night. MTV will document the tour for a special entitled Diary of Jay-Z: Water for Life which will air on November 24.
Jay had the following to say about his decision to launch the tour:
"If you bring awareness to other young people, they're gonna see [that] and want to be involved. I'm not a politician I'm just a regular person with a heart. If you see a problem like that and do nothing about it, there's something wrong with you."
While the itinerary is yet to be finalized, we do know that the tour is set to kick-off September 9 in Poland. As soon as the tour dates are confirmed, well be sure to let you know.
